The ECOVACS WINBOT W3 OMNI is a high-end robot window cleaner designed for large or high-rise windows. Its standout feature is the automatic self-cleaning station that washes the mop pads after each use, making it very easy to maintain without manual scrubbing. The battery lasts about 130 minutes, which is enough for several cleaning sessions, and it has a decent 1.1-liter water tank combined with a triple-nozzle spray system for effective dirt loosening. Equipped with smart WIN-SLAM 5.0 navigation, it moves precisely and avoids obstacles, cleaning edges thoroughly thanks to its TruEdge technology.
One trade-off is its relatively heavy weight at over 12 kg, which might make setup less convenient compared to lighter models. The suction is strong and backed by safety features like anti-fall and safety tethers, making it safe to use on high and exterior windows. While it handles everyday dust and fingerprints well, very dirty windows may require multiple cleaning cycles or rinsing the pad to avoid streaks.
This robot is well suited for users who want a mostly hands-free, reliable solution for regular window upkeep, especially on large or hard-to-reach panes, though it might feel bulky and a bit pricey for occasional or small-scale use.

The ECOVACS WINBOT W2S Omni is a smart window cleaning robot designed especially for large or hard-to-reach glass surfaces like floor-to-ceiling windows. It offers about 110 minutes of battery life, which is solid enough for cleaning multiple windows in one go without needing a recharge. Its water tank capacity is quite small (80 microliters), so it’s best suited for light cleaning tasks like removing dust and fingerprints rather than heavy dirt or stains. The robot weighs around 7.27 kilograms, which is on the heavier side for easy handling but helps with strong suction and stability on the glass.
The WINBOT uses a powerful 12-level safety system that keeps it firmly attached to windows, giving users peace of mind especially for high or exterior windows. It features TruEdge technology to clean very close to window edges and triple wide-angle spray nozzles that improve cleaning coverage and reduce the need for repeated passes. The device is controlled via an app, and the included 6-in-1 portable OMNI station adds convenience by combining power supply, controls, and cable management, allowing cordless operation in places without nearby outlets.
While the relatively small water tank means refilling might be needed for larger jobs and its weight might make setup a bit more challenging, this WINBOT model offers advanced features and strong safety measures that stand out in its category. It is well-suited for anyone with many large windows or hard-to-reach spots who wants a reliable, mostly hands-off cleaning solution.

The HUTT Window Cleaning Robot offers a unique and effective approach to cleaning with its world-first Round-Square Dual-Stage Cleaning technology. This means it combines circular and square cleaning motions to better reach edges and corners, which many other robots miss. It has strong suction power at 6500Pa, paired with a constant pressure system that mimics manual scrubbing, so it cleans stubborn stains without damaging your glass. The robot’s 80ml water tank is decent, covering up to about 646 square feet per fill, which should be enough for multiple windows before needing a refill. Battery life lasts 30 minutes with a backup power system that keeps the robot attached even during a power outage, adding safety and reliability. Weighing only 1.3kg (around 3 pounds), it’s light enough to handle easily, and it runs relatively quietly at 65dB, which is about the noise of a normal conversation.
The device’s advanced sensors and smart navigation help it clean efficiently without bumping into obstacles or falling. It supports various cleaning modes and works on flat and some curved glass like shower doors and mirrors, making it versatile. On the downside, the 30-minute battery life might limit cleaning very large window surfaces without pausing for charging. Also, the water tank size, while practical, might require refilling during extended use. The robot requires some setup, including attaching the safety rope and using the remote control, which may need a short learning curve for some users.
This robot is well suited for homeowners or small businesses that want a thorough, automated window cleaning with strong suction and smart features, especially for medium-sized window areas and surfaces that need edge and corner attention.
